Description
This compound belongs to the class of organic compounds known as jatrophane and cyclojatrophane diterpenoids. These are diterpenoids with a structure based on the jatrophane or the 9,13-jatrophane skeleton. Jatrophane can be derived from casbane by 6,10-cyclization and opening of the cyclopropane. Cyclojatrophane diterpenoids are based on the 9,13-cyclization of the jatrophane skeleton yields the 9,13-cyclojatrophane skeleton.
